rep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Make more use of REG_NREGS
2017-08-30
rsandifo
[1/77]
Add an E_ prefix to mode names
commit
|
commitdiff
|
tree
2017-08-30
rsand
i
f
o
Sp
l
it out part
s
of
s
com
p
ar
e
_
l
oc_descriptor an
d
emit_store_f
l
ag
commit
|
commitdiff
|
tree
2017-08-30
rsa
n
dif
o
[rs6000] int-
>
machine_mode in rs6000-c
.
c
commit
|
commitdiff
|
tree
2017-08-29
rsandif
o
Set th
e
call nothrow flag more ofte
n
commit
|
commitdiff
|
tree
2017-08-24
r
s
a
nd
i
fo
Make more
u
s
e of s
u
breg_offse
t
_from_
l
sb
commit
|
commitdiff
|
tree
2017-08-22
rsandif
o
Make more us
e
of parado
x
ical_s
u
breg_p
commit
|
commitdiff
|
tree
2017-08-22
rsa
n
di
f
o
[AArch64] Fix l
a
bel mode
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
Simpli
f
y pad_below i
m
plementation
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
Remove
t
he f
r
ame siz
e
argument from function_prologue
.
.
.
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
Add a
type_ha
s
_m
o
de_precisi
o
n_p helper f
u
nct
i
on
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
Move vector_type_mod
e
to tre
e
.
c
commit
|
commitdiff
|
tree
2017-08-21
rsand
i
f
o
Pass rtx and index
to read-md
.
c ite
r
ator routines
commit
|
commitdiff
|
tree
2017-08-21
rsan
d
ifo
F
i
x bogus
CONST_WIDE_IN
T
hash
commit
|
commitdiff
|
tree
2017-08-17
r
sand
i
fo
Ad
d
missing ECF_NOTHROW fl
a
g
s to i
n
ternal
.
d
ef
commit
|
commitdiff
|
tree
2017-08-16
rsan
d
ifo
PR818
1
5: Invalid conditi
o
nal reducti
o
n
commit
|
commitdiff
|
tree
2017-08-10
rsandifo
PR81738: Split vec
t
-alias-check-6
.
c
commit
|
commitdiff
|
tree
2017-08-04
rsandifo
Pool alignment i
n
form
a
tion
for c
o
mm
o
n bases
commit
|
commitdiff
|
tree
2017-08-04
rsandifo
C++-
i
fy
v
ec_in
f
o
structures
commit
|
commitdiff
|
tree
2017-08-04
r
s
and
i
fo
U
se
b
ase i
n
e
quali
t
y fo
r
some vector
a
lias check
s
commit
|
commitdiff
|
tree
2017-08-04
rsan
d
ifo
Handle data dependenc
e
relations with diffe
r
ent bases
commit
|
commitdiff
|
tree
2017-07-27
rsandi
f
o
[r
s
6000] Avoi
d
r
otates of
f
l
oating-point modes
commit
|
commitdiff
|
tree
2017-07-08
r
s
andifo
Fix coretypes
.
h-re
l
ated de
p
endencies
commit
|
commitdiff
|
tree
2017-07-08
r
s
and
i
fo
Force a
d
epen
d
e
n
c
e
dista
n
ce of 1 i
n
gna
t
.
dg/
v
ect17
.
adb
commit
|
commitdiff
|
tree
2017-07-05
rsand
i
fo
Use SET_DECL_MOD
E
in libc
c
1
commit
|
commitdiff
|
tree
2017-07-05
rsandifo
Remov
e
enum b
e
fore machin
e
_
mode
commit
|
commitdiff
|
tree
2017-07-04
rsandifo
PR 81292
:
ICE on related st
r
lens after r
2
49880
commit
|
commitdiff
|
tree
2017-07-03
rsan
d
i
f
o
A
v
oid minimum - 1 confusion in vec
t
oriser
commit
|
commitdiff
|
tree
2017-07-03
r
s
andi
f
o
Add
a helper
for gett
i
ng the
overal
l
align
m
e
nt of a D
R
commit
|
commitdiff
|
tree
2017-07-03
r
s
andifo
Add DR_BAS
E
_ALIGNMENT
a
n
d
DR
_
B
ASE_MISALI
G
N
M
E
N
T
commit
|
commitdiff
|
tree
2017-07-03
r
san
d
i
fo
Add
DR_STEP_ALIGNMENT
commit
|
commitdiff
|
tree
2017-07-03
rsa
n
d
i
f
o
Rename DR_A
L
IGNED_T
O
to DR
_
OFFSET_ALIGNMENT
commit
|
commitdiff
|
tree
2017-07-03
rsand
i
fo
Make dr_analyze_innermost oper
a
te on innermost_loop_behavi
o
r
commit
|
commitdiff
|
tree
2017-07-03
rsandifo
Use in
n
ermo
s
t_lo
o
p_behavi
o
r
for outer loop vectorisation
commit
|
commitdiff
|
tree
2017-07-03
rsandi
f
o
Twe
a
k BB analys
i
s
f
or dr_analyze_innermo
s
t
commit
|
commitdiff
|
tree
2017-07-02
rsandifo
Reo
r
ganise machmo
d
e
.
h headers
commit
|
commitdiff
|
tree
2017-07-02
rsandifo
Mak
e
tree-ssa-strlen
.
c handle
p
artia
l
unte
r
minated
.
.
.
commit
|
commitdiff
|
tree
2017-07-02
rsandifo
P
R 80769: Inco
r
rect strlen
optimisation
commit
|
commitdiff
|
tree
2017-07-02
r
sandi
f
o
PR81136: ICE
from inconsisten
t
DR
_
MISALIGNMENTs
commit
|
commitdiff
|
tree
2017-06-12
rsandifo
Fix pessimistic D
I
mode handling in comb
i
ne
.
c:ma
k
e_f
i
e
ld_assi
.
.
.
commit
|
commitdiff
|
tree
2017-06-07
rsandifo
Clari
f
y define_insn documentation
commit
|
commitdiff
|
tree
2017-05-31
rsandifo
[1/
2
] Add get_nex
t
_strin
f
o
h
el
p
er fu
n
ction
commit
|
commitdiff
|
tree
2017-05-31
r
s
andifo
Altern
a
tive c
h
e
c
k
for
vector refs with sa
m
e alignment
commit
|
commitdiff
|
tree
2017-05-08
rsandifo
[
A
Arch64] Tighten m
o
ve constraints for symboli
c
o
perands
commit
|
commitdiff
|
tree
2017-05-06
rsandif
o
Re
c
o
r
d equivalence
s
for spill
registers
commit
|
commitdiff
|
tree
2017-05-06
rsandifo
PR 75964:
I
nvalid in
t
ege
r
ABS ha
n
dling in simplify
.
.
.
commit
|
commitdiff
|
tree
2017-05-04
rs
a
ndifo
Cap niter_for_unr
o
lle
d
_loop to upper bound
commit
|
commitdiff
|
tree
2017-05-04
rsan
d
ifo
Fix p
r
evious com
m
it
commit
|
commitdiff
|
tree
2017-05-04
rsandifo
Re
m
ove b
o
gus top-level ChangeLog
c
ommit (s
o
rry!)
commit
|
commitdiff
|
tree
2017-05-03
rsandifo
Wrap t
r
e
e
-
data-ref
.
h
macro
a
rguments
commit
|
commitdiff
|
tree
2017-03-10
rsa
n
d
ifo
[
libstd
c
+
+
-
v3] Fix detecti
o
n of obs
o
le
t
e
isna
n
commit
|
commitdiff
|
tree
2017-01-13
rsandifo
Avo
i
d excessively-big hash tables in e
m
pty
-
add cycles
commit
|
commitdiff
|
tree
2017-01-13
r
s
andifo
S
hort-circuit alt_fail case
i
n
r
e
cord_reg
_
c
l
asses
commit
|
commitdiff
|
tree
2016-12-24
rsan
d
ifo
Ma
k
e
it
ch
e
a
per
to
t
est wh
e
th
e
r an SSA name is a virtua
l
.
.
.
commit
|
commitdiff
|
tree
2016-11-25
rsandi
f
o
T
w
eak LRA
h
and
l
ing of
shared spill slot
s
commit
|
commitdiff
|
tree
2016-11-25
rsandifo
Set mode of decimal float
s
before ca
l
ling layou
t
_ty
p
e
commit
|
commitdiff
|
tree
2016-11-25
rsandifo
Add
r
un tests for re
c
en
t
sibcall p
a
tches
commit
|
commitdiff
|
tree
2016-11-25
rsa
n
d
ifo
Tighte
n
check for whether sibca
l
l references loca
l
.
.
.
commit
|
commitdiff
|
tree
2016-11-23
rsandifo
Rework sub
r
eg_get_
i
nfo
commit
|
commitdiff
|
tree
2016-11-23
rsandifo
Add mo
r
e
su
b
reg offs
e
t
h
el
p
ers
commit
|
commitdiff
|
tree
2016-11-21
rsandifo
Han
d
le s
i
bcal
l
s wit
h
aggregate re
t
urn
s
commit
|
commitdiff
|
tree
2016-11-18
rsandifo
Make lo
a
d_exte
n
d_op an inline functi
o
n
commit
|
commitdiff
|
tree
2016-11-18
rsan
d
ifo
Use rtx_mode_
t
inst
e
ad of std::make
_
p
air
commit
|
commitdiff
|
tree
2016-11-18
rs
a
n
d
ifo
Add SET_DECL_MODE
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Fix nb_iterations
calculat
i
o
n in tree-vect-loop-manip
.
c
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
An alternative fix for PR
7
0944
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Fi
x
vec_cmp comparison mode
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Use df_read_modify_
s
ubreg_p in
cprop
.
c
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Optimise CONCAT ha
n
dling i
n
emit_
g
rou
p
_loa
d
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Fix
handling of unknown si
z
es in rt
x
_addr
_
c
an_trap_p
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Fi
x
nb_iter
a
tions_e
s
timate calculation in tree-v
e
c
t
.
.
.
commit
|
commitdiff
|
tree
2016-11-16
r
sandi
f
o
Fix p
d
p
1
1 build
commit
|
commitdiff
|
tree
2016-11-16
r
s
andifo
Fi
x
missing bracket
s
in ar
c
.
c
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
F
i
x
i
nstances of
gen_rtx_REG (VOIDmode,
.
.
.
)
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
U
s
e MEM_SIZ
E
rat
h
er th
a
n
GET_MO
D
E
_
SIZE in dc
e
.
c
commit
|
commitdiff
|
tree
2016-11-15
rsa
n
difo
Use
s
implif
y
_ge
n
_binary
i
n canon_
r
t
x
commit
|
commitdiff
|
tree
2016-11-15
r
san
d
ifo
Add a lo
a
d_extend_op w
r
a
pper
commit
|
commitdiff
|
tree
2016-11-15
rsand
i
fo
Fix simpl
i
fy_shift_c
o
nst_1 handling of
v
ector shifts
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Mov
e
misplaced assignment in num_s
i
gn_bit_copies1
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Fix scr
i
pto
in ChangeL
o
g
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Fix a GET_MODE_
C
LASS
typo in
m
e
m_loc_descripto
r
commit
|
commitdiff
|
tree
2016-07-06
rs
a
ndifo
[7/
7
]
Add ne
g
ative and zero s
t
rides to vect_memory_a
c
ces
s
_type
commit
|
commitdiff
|
tree
2016-07-06
rsan
d
ifo
[6/7] Explicitly clas
s
ify ve
c
tor loads and
s
t
or
e
s
commit
|
commitdiff
|
tree
2016-07-06
rsandifo
[5/7] Move the f
i
x
f
o
r PR65518
commit
|
commitdiff
|
tree
2016-07-06
rsa
n
d
ifo
[
4/7] Add a gather_sca
t
t
er_
i
nfo
s
t
ructure
commit
|
commitdiff
|
tree
2016-07-06
rsandifo
[3/7] Fix load/s
t
o
r
e c
o
sts fo
r
strid
e
d gro
u
ps
commit
|
commitdiff
|
tree
2016-07-06
rsandifo
[
2
/7] Clean
u
p vecto
r
izer
l
oad/store costs
commit
|
commitdiff
|
tree
2016-07-06
rsandi
f
o
[1/7] Remov
e
unne
c
essary peeling
f
or gap
s
chec
k
commit
|
commitdiff
|
tree
2016-06-08
rsandifo
R
emove word
_
mode
h
ack for split bitfiel
d
s
commit
|
commitdiff
|
tree
2016-05-26
rsa
n
d
i
fo
Fix ivopt
s
estimates for internal f
u
nctions
commit
|
commitdiff
|
tree
2016-05-24
rsandif
o
Clean
up
P
URE_SLP_STMT handling
commit
|
commitdiff
|
tree
2016-05-24
rsandifo
Avoid unnecessar
y
p
e
eling f
o
r ga
p
s wi
t
h LD3
commit
|
commitdiff
|
tree
2016-05-24
rsandifo
Fix
GROUP_GAP for single-elem
e
n
t
i
n
t
erleaving
commit
|
commitdiff
|
tree
2016-05-18
rsa
n
difo
To: gcc-pa
t
ches@gcc
.
gnu
.
org
commit
|
commitdiff
|
tree
2016-05-09
rsandifo
Fix handling of negative bitpos in expand_d
e
bug
_
expr
commit
|
commitdiff
|
tree
2016-05-09
r
s
and
i
fo
Miss
i
n
g
pointer
d
erefer
e
n
c
e
in tree-af
f
ine
.
c
commit
|
commitdiff
|
tree
2016-05-03
rsa
n
difo
PR 70
6
8
7
: Use wide_int in combine
.
c:change_zero_e
x
t
commit
|
commitdiff
|
tree
2016-05-02
r
san
d
ifo
S
i
mplify cst_and_fits_in_hwi
commit
|
commitdiff
|
tree
2016-05-02
rs
a
ndifo
Add a wi::to_wide helper f
u
nctio
n
commit
|
commitdiff
|
tree
2016-05-02
rsandifo
Support
<
<
a
nd >> for off
s
et_int a
n
d wides
t
_int
commit
|
commitdiff
|
tree
2016-05-02
rsandifo
Support <, <=, > a
n
d
>= for offset_int an
d
widest_int
commit
|
commitdiff
|
tree
next